CHICAGO — When Taylor Raddysh missed practice earlier this month for what was described as personal reasons, the Rangers wing was spending precious time with his dad, Dwayne, and his family.

Dwayne was diagnosed with stage four pancreatic cancer and given 4-6 months to live in mid-May, around the time Raddysh and his then-team, the Capitals, were eliminated in the second round of the playoffs last season.
